What is a VPN?
One virtual private network (VPN) creates a secure connection to the internet.
It uses encryption to protect your data, so your browsing and personal information are more secure.

VPNs protect your internet from hackers. They also change your IP address, keeping your online identity secret.
VPNs are used for many things.
They protect your public Wi-Fi, give you access to restricted content, and hide your browsing history.
They are also safe for online shopping.

How do VPNs work?
VPNs secure your internet connection by creating a encrypted tunnel.
This tunnel prevents third parties from seeing your data on the internet.
This way, your communication remains secure and private.
VPNs also hide your IP address.
This allows you to access websites from different parts of the world without revealing where you are. This helps keep your online identity safe from hackers and governments.

Types of VPNs
There are different types of VPNs for different needs.
Personal VPNs help protect the online privacy and access restricted content.
Over 60% of home users use these VPNs to access blocked websites.
Remote Access VPNs are used in companies.
They allow employees to access the company network securely, even when they are away.
About 25% of corporate employees use these VPNs to connect securely.
In companies, about 80% use Corporate VPNs to connect offices.
These VPNs are essential for protecting corporate data.

How to Choose the Right VPN
Choosing a VPN requires attention to several aspects.
First, look at the provider's privacy policy.
It's best to choose those that don't log your online activities. This ensures more privacy.
Another important point is the encryption used.
Opt for providers that use AES-256 encryption and protocols like WireGuard. This helps keep your connection secure and fast.
Also consider how easy the apps are to use.
A simple and easy-to-use interface greatly improves your experience.
Additionally, it is important that the VPN works across multiple devices and operating systems.
Good customer support is also essential.
24/7 support can be crucial in case of problems.
Add value to the service with extra tools like ad blockers.

Disadvantages and Limitations
VPNs bring many benefits, but they also have limitations.
One disadvantage of VPN common is the reduction of the connection speed.
Encryption can make the internet slower, affecting browsing.
For example, even quality providers like Hotspot Shield can have a slower connection.
This can change the experience of using the internet.
Another important point is streaming policies.
Netflix, for example, uses VPN blockers to prevent access.
But, services like ExpressVPN work to ensure secure access to many streaming catalogs.
Additionally, VPNs can experience connection drops.
Without a kill switch, the real IP address may be exposed.

The kill switch is another important feature.
It stops the internet connection if the VPN disconnects.
So, your data protection remains active. For journalists and whistleblowers, these features are essential to maintaining secure communication.
Using a VPN with double encryption can make your internet slower.
This happens because the data passes through two VPN servers. NordVPN is a good choice for those looking for extra security without losing privacy.
